The State Secretariat for Agriculture, Livestock and Supply (Seapa) has launched a project called "Promotion of Quality Cachaça in Minas Gerais" to encourage the legalization of cachaça production and reduce the sector's clandestinity. The project will include efforts such as encouraging regularization, organizing institutional events and lectures on health education and technical training, as well as business roundtables in Minas Gerais and internationally. The project aims to update the legislation regulating cachaça production in Minas Gerais and assist cachaça producers in joining the formal sector and producing high-quality cachaça.
